Miroir Postgreql
Postgresql.org est le dépôt officiel de la communauté Postgresql.
Nous importons la clé GPG du dépôt
wget -q -O - https://www.postgresql.org/media/keys/ACCC4CF8.asc | gpg --no-default-keyring --keyring trustedkeys.gpg --import
Si vous avez en retour ce genre de message
bash: gpg : commande introuvable
Il faut installer le paquet gnupg
sudo aptitude install gnupg
Nous créons le miroir
aptly mirror create -architectures=amd64 bookworm-pgsql http://apt.postgresql.org/pub/repos/apt bookworm-pgdg main
Nous mettons à jour le miroir local
aptly mirror update bookworm-pgsql
Nous créons un snapshot
aptly snapshot create bookworm-pgsql-230706 from mirror bookworm-pgsql
Nous publions le snapshot
aptly publish snapshot -distribution=bookworm-pgsql -component=main bookworm-pgsql-230706 debian
Si le dépôt a déjà été publié, nous “switchons” le snapshot
aptly publish switch bookworm-pgsql debian bookworm-pgsql-230706